Connecting the Cables
•
Connect either end of the supplied laser data cable to
the laser’s serial port and the other end to the
TruAngle’s serial port labeled “LASER”.
•
Connect one end of the download cable to the data
collector and the other end to the TruAngle’s serial port
labeled “DATA”.
Cable Crimp
As Figure #6 shows, the side bracket design includes a cable
crimp. You can use the cable crimp to hold the cables and keep
them from interfering with your work.
Leveling the TruAngle
The bubble level is used to level the TruAngle.
1. Look at the position of the bubble within the bubble
level. When the bubble is centered inside the circle, the
TruAngle is level.
2. To align the bubble within the circle, adjust the tribach
or tripod the TruAngle is mounted on.
Looking at Figure #7, the yellow dot represents the
bubble. [A] shows that the TruAngle is not level. [B]
shows that the TruAngle is level.
